Parts of Burnham-On-Sea seafront hit by 12-hour power cut

-

A power cut left several Burnham-On-Sea seafront properties without electricity for over 12 hours on Friday (December 22nd).

Parts of the North Esplanade were plunged into darkness just after 1am – and power was not fully restored until around 1.45pm due to an underground cable fault.

But Western Power Distribution has been praised for its response by several affected residents.

Phoebe Pearce at the Round Tower Guesthouse told Burnham-On-Sea.com: “Western Power’s response cannot be faulted – they were very quickly on scene in the middle of the night to try and sort out the fault.”

“They were so helpful and courteous and offered us an emergency generator to keep us operational.”

“Our power was restored after 12 hours, once the team had worked through the day to make the repairs, and I think they need to be thanked – they really provided superb customer service.”
